  • Patent number: 4298777
    Abstract: A crash force sensor is disclosed which may be used to activate emergency location systems such as a transmitter or an inflatable aerial tethered balloon. The crash force sensor comprises a casing and a moveable seismic mass held within the casing. A plurality of friction pads and friction plates surround the mass in order to increase friction between the mass and the casing while allowing the mass the slide through said casing when a force of predetermined magnitude and direction is experienced. A pressure responsive means such as a spring extends between the mass and one end of the casing, and signal means is coupled to the mass to provide an indication of the pattern of force experienced by the sensor. The sensor may also include air damping means to impede the reaction of the mass to spring force after crash acceleration or deceleration has ceased.

  • Patent number: 4185582
    Abstract: A distress signal device comprising an inflatable balloon, a tether line with one end attached to the balloon and its other end attached to a casing and a gas cartridge or vial containing water or ammonium halide solution and metal hydride crystals located within the casing. A cartridge actuator apparatus is also provided which comprises a spring loaded pin axially aligned with the end of the glass vial, a line connected to a blunt end of the pin with the other end of the line being looped around an inclined leg of a support member connected to the inner side wall of the casing and a rod. A ball weight is connected by a universal joint to the lower end of the rod, and coil springs are located between the inner casing wall and the ball weight on all sides so that upon an impact of predetermined force the ball weight moves a sufficient distance to release the rod causing the pin to puncture the glass vial to allow mixing of the liquid and crystals to inflate the balloon.

  • Patent number: 4014410
    Abstract: A brake system which utilizes a disc movably mounted on a rotating member such as a shaft, wheel hub or an axle, so that the disc may be tilted at an obtuse angle to the rotating member. A caliper forming two or more hydraulic cylinders and holding associated pistons is mounted adjacent the disc with the ends of the pistons being positioned on opposite sides of the disc. Friction pads are secured to the ends of the pistons. A master cylinder communicates with the caliper held cylinders through a fluid circuit. The fluid circuit includes a direct line leading to the master cylinder, a by-pass line leading to the master cylinder and a line leading from the cylinders of one side to the cylinders of the other side. A one way check valve is positioned in the direct line leading to the master cylinder and a shut-off valve is positioned in the by-pass line.

  • Patent number: 4006453
    Abstract: A device for adapting combined brake and turn signal lights on a trailer to independent brake signal and turn signal lights on a towing vehicle has two circuits, one for each side, each circuit having a brake signal switch, such as a transistor, silicon-controlled rectifier or relay connected between the brake signal circuit of the vehicle and the filament of the combined brake and turn signal light on the corresponding side of the trailer. The brake signal switches are selectively actuated by impulses received from the corresponding turn signal flashers on the vehicle, to block the brake signal current to the corresponding signal light on the trailer. In one embodiment of the invention, voltage-sensitive switches (e.g., SCR) are connected to brake switch transistors, and the left-hand and right-hand turn signal circuits on the vehicle are connected through diodes to the corresponding signal lamps on the trailer, and also to their respective switches.
